Prevention: Your First Line of Defense
Preventing frozen pipes begins with proactive measures. Here are some essential steps to protect your plumbing system:
- Insulate Your Pipes: Pipe insulation is a simple yet effective way to prevent freezing. Focus on pipes located in unheated areas such as basements, attics, and garages. Insulating sleeves or heat tape can provide an extra layer of protection.
- Seal Cracks and Openings: Cold air can seep into your home through cracks and openings, increasing the risk of frozen pipes. Inspect your home for any gaps around windows, doors, and the foundation, and seal them with caulk or weatherstripping.
- Maintain a Consistent Temperature: Keep your thermostat set to a consistent temperature, even when you’re away. This helps ensure that your pipes remain warm enough to prevent freezing.
- Open Cabinet Doors: In areas where pipes are located inside cabinets, such as under sinks, keep the doors open to allow warm air to circulate around the pipes.
- Let Faucets Drip: During extreme cold spells, let faucets drip slightly. This keeps water moving through the pipes, reducing the risk of freezing.

Detection: Recognizing the Warning Signs
Early detection of frozen pipes can prevent a minor inconvenience from becoming a major disaster. Here are some signs to watch for:
- Reduced Water Flow: If you notice a sudden decrease in water flow, it could indicate a frozen pipe. Check all faucets and fixtures to identify the affected area.
- Frost on Pipes: Visible frost on exposed pipes is a clear sign that they are at risk of freezing. Take immediate action to warm the pipes and prevent further freezing.
- Strange Odors: A foul smell coming from your faucets or drains could indicate a blockage caused by a frozen pipe.
Quick Fixes: Addressing Frozen Pipes
If you suspect that your pipes have frozen, it’s crucial to act quickly to minimize damage. Here’s what you can do:
- Turn Off the Water Supply: If a pipe has burst, immediately turn off the main water supply to prevent flooding.
- Thawing Frozen Pipes: Use a hairdryer or space heater to gently warm the frozen section of the pipe. Start from the faucet and work your way back to the frozen area. Avoid using open flames or high heat, as this can damage the pipes.
- Call for Emergency Plumbing Services: If you’re unable to thaw the pipes or if a pipe has burst, contact a professional plumber immediately.
